Transaction 765156eb038076ac97d2b957fef468acb0346f589eaf8d59e416c87de48f7959
1 Input
1 Output
-
765156eb038076ac97d2b957fef468acb0346f589eaf8d59e416c87de48f7959:0
- value
- 25000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 32d0252b7034e2a4695fe705c12f6349eeadaba07b02603af192e5c1c83a8a8e
- address
- bc1pxtgz22msxn32g62luuzuztmrf8h2m2aq0vpxqwh3jtjurjp6328qkxadwp